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ions Google Chrome versions prior to 106.0.5249.119 Microsoft Edge (affected versions not specified)
Description The issue allows a remote attacker to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ted HTML page. This could lead to unauthorized access to sensitive data, disruption of data integrity, and denial of service. The exploitation is related to a use-after-free vulnerability in the Skia component.
Recommendations For Google Chrome versions prior to 106.0.5249.119, update to version 106.0.5249.119 or later to resolve the issue. For Microsoft Edge, at the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
